Well all that other stuff has changed now, mostly. I blew up the flathead driving it way too much while it was tached out sooooooooo... i had no choice but throw in that 360 a little early iI added some bolton mods to it did some. Here it is still unfinished.... This is just a months worth of work and on a very tight budget but its back as a daily driver, i did all the work on this truck, nothing was done by others except the exhaust system cause i dont have a tubing bender.

360 with a few beautification and speed parts, Weiand stealth dual plane intake, has a holley on in the pic but i put an edelbrock 750 on, headman full length headers, and Mopar performance valve covers and aircleaner housing.31546's 1958 Dodge D-Series Pick-Up
The frame... had to notchit a little to clear the headers..looks clean painted though 31546's 1958 Dodge D-Series Pick-Up
4 days after i got it goin...yes thats about $100 worth of tire and its all on the fender, workin on the other one now.......definite traction problems i hope to make it up with a sure-grip unit but that wont come till a few more paychecks.
